However exactly what does this involve, and how can it benefit those looking for support for their mental wellness? What is a Private Psychiatrist? A private psychiatrist is a competent medical physician concentrating on detecting, dealing with, and managing mental health disorders. Unlike psychologists or therapists who mostly focus on talk therapy (such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y), psychiatrists are distinct due to the fact that they are accredited to prescribe medication alongside providing treatment. A “private” psychiatrist operates outside the public healthcare system, providing services through independent practices or private clinics. Why Choose a Private Psychiatrist? What Can You Expect in a Session? Your very first appointment with a private psychiatrist will normally be a detailed assessment of your mental health history, current signs, lifestyle, and personal goals. Psychiatrists count on this detailed information to develop customized treatment plans. Depending on the diagnosis, treatment may involve: Medication: Psychiatrists might prescribe medications such as antidepressants, antipsychotics, state of mind stabilizers, or anti-anxiety drugs to assist manage chemical imbalances in the brain. Treatment: Some psychiatrists incorporate treatment into their practice, using psychotherapeutic interventions like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) or psychoanalysis. Referrals: In cases requiring additional or holistic care, a psychiatrist might collaborate with psychologists, counselors, or other doctor. Sessions are private and developed to produce a safe area for you to explore your feelings, obstacles, and goals for healing. How to Find a Private Psychiatrist For those considering private psychiatric care, here are some steps to discover a qualified expert: Research Study Credentials: Ensure the psychiatrist is accredited and licensed by the suitable medical board in your country. Check Out Reviews and Recommendations: Online reviews and individual recommendations from trusted sources can provide insight into a psychiatrist's expertise and bedside way. Examine Specializations: Look for a psychiatrist who specializes in your specific area of concern, such as child psychiatry, addiction, or injury. Think About Costs: Private care can be pricey, so ask about consultation fees and whether your medical insurance covers any part of the cost. Schedule a Preliminary Consultation: Meeting the psychiatrist and discussing your needs can help you choose if the professional is an excellent fit for you.
